The dual spindle lathe is a production powerhouse designed for high-volume manufacturing where minimizing cycle time is critical. Its primary application is in the automotive, consumer goods, and industrial component sectors, where it enables the simultaneous machining of two identical parts. Each spindle operates independently within a single workstation, effectively doubling the output of components like shafts, connectors, and fasteners. This parallel processing capability drastically reduces cost per part and provides an unparalleled return on investment for mass production environments.
Beyond raw output, the dual spindle configuration is indispensable for complex parts that require complete machining on both ends. This is vital in the aerospace, medical, and defense industries for components like hydraulic fittings, valve bodies, and surgical tool parts. The machine can rough a part on the first spindle and then automatically transfer it to the second spindle for finishing, back-side operations, and secondary processes like cross-drilling. This "done-in-one" methodology guarantees perfect alignment, eliminates the need for a second machine setup, and ensures the highest levels of accuracy and consistency for intricate components.
The application of dual spindle technology is a direct pathway to advanced, unattended manufacturing. These machines are the ideal platform for integrated automation, easily paired with robotic part loaders to create lights-out production cells. By processing two parts per cycle or a complete part from start to finish, they maximize the uptime and efficiency of automated systems.
